Surface Preparation: Clean, dry, and smooth surfaces ensure better stencil adhesion and paint longevity on bridges
When preparing to stencil on bridges, surface preparation is a critical step that directly impacts the success and longevity of the project. Cleaning the surface is the first and most essential task. Bridges are exposed to various environmental factors such as dirt, grime, grease, and even mold or mildew, especially in humid areas. These contaminants can prevent proper stencil adhesion and cause paint to peel or chip prematurely. Use a high-pressure washer or a stiff brush with a suitable cleaning solution to remove all debris. For stubborn stains or graffiti, consider using a graffiti remover or a mild solvent, ensuring it is compatible with the bridge’s material (e.g., concrete, metal, or wood). Thoroughly rinse the area and allow it to dry completely before proceeding.
Once the surface is clean, ensuring it is completely dry is equally important. Moisture trapped beneath the stencil or paint can lead to bubbling, cracking, or poor adhesion. Depending on the climate and humidity levels, this may take several hours or even a full day. Use a moisture meter to confirm dryness, especially on porous surfaces like concrete. If working on a tight schedule, consider using a fan or heater to expedite the drying process, but avoid excessive heat that could damage the bridge material. A dry surface not only improves stencil adhesion but also ensures the paint cures properly, enhancing its durability.
Achieving a smooth surface is another key aspect of preparation. Rough or uneven areas can cause the stencil to lift, resulting in blurry or uneven paint application. For concrete bridges, use a concrete grinder or sander to smooth out any rough patches or imperfections. On metal surfaces, remove rust or corrosion with a wire brush or sandpaper, and apply a rust-inhibiting primer if necessary. For wooden bridges, sand the surface to remove splinters or old paint, ensuring a uniform texture. Filling in cracks or holes with an appropriate patching compound can also create a seamless base for stenciling. A smooth surface allows the stencil to lay flat, ensuring crisp, clean lines in the final design.
In addition to cleaning, drying, and smoothing, priming the surface can further enhance adhesion and paint longevity. A primer acts as a bonding agent between the bridge material and the paint, improving durability and resistance to weathering. Choose a primer suitable for the bridge’s material and the type of paint being used. Apply the primer evenly, following the manufacturer’s instructions, and allow it to dry completely before stenciling. This extra step is particularly important for bridges exposed to harsh weather conditions, as it provides an additional layer of protection against UV rays, moisture, and temperature fluctuations.
Finally, inspecting the surface one last time before stenciling ensures all preparation steps have been completed correctly. Check for any remaining dirt, moisture, or rough spots that may have been missed. Address any issues immediately to avoid complications during the stenciling process. Proper surface preparation not only guarantees better stencil adhesion but also extends the life of the paint, ensuring the bridge’s aesthetic appeal and structural integrity are maintained over time. By investing time in thorough preparation, the stenciled design will be more vibrant, precise, and long-lasting, making the effort well worth it.

Paint Selection: Use weather-resistant, high-durability paints to withstand bridge environmental conditions effectively
When selecting paint for bridge stenciling, it is crucial to prioritize weather-resistant and high-durability options to ensure longevity and maintain appearance despite harsh environmental conditions. Bridges are constantly exposed to elements such as rain, snow, UV radiation, temperature fluctuations, and humidity, which can cause paint to fade, crack, or peel over time. Therefore, choosing a paint specifically formulated to withstand these challenges is essential for a successful and lasting stenciling project.
Weather-resistant paints are designed to repel moisture, preventing water infiltration that can lead to rust and corrosion on metal surfaces commonly found in bridges. Look for paints with advanced water-resistant properties, such as those containing hydrophobic additives or resins that create a barrier against moisture. Additionally, UV-resistant paints are vital to combat the fading and degradation caused by prolonged sun exposure. These paints often include pigments and additives that absorb or reflect UV rays, preserving the vibrancy and integrity of the stenciled design.
High-durability paints are another critical factor in bridge stenciling. Bridges experience constant vibration, foot traffic, and in some cases, vehicle traffic, which can wear down paint over time. Opt for paints with excellent adhesion and flexibility to resist chipping and cracking under stress. Acrylic-based or epoxy paints are often recommended for their superior durability, as they form a tough, protective layer that can withstand abrasion and impact. These paints also tend to have better color retention, ensuring the stenciled artwork remains vivid and clear for years.
Environmental considerations should also guide paint selection. Choose low-VOC (Volatile Organic Compound) or zero-VOC paints to minimize environmental impact and comply with regulations, especially in urban areas. Water-based paints are generally more eco-friendly and easier to work with, offering good durability and weather resistance when formulated for exterior use. However, for extremely harsh conditions, solvent-based paints might be more suitable due to their enhanced durability and moisture resistance, though they require careful handling due to higher VOC content.
Lastly, consider the specific conditions of the bridge location. Coastal bridges, for example, require paints with additional corrosion protection due to saltwater exposure, which accelerates rusting. In such cases, marine-grade paints or those with anti-corrosive additives are ideal. For bridges in areas with extreme temperature variations, select paints that remain flexible in cold weather and resistant to heat-induced softening. By carefully evaluating these factors and choosing the right paint, you can ensure that your stenciled bridge artwork remains vibrant and intact, even in the most demanding environments.

Stencil Materials: Choose sturdy, reusable stencils capable of handling large-scale bridge applications without tearing
When considering stenciling on bridges, the choice of stencil material is crucial to ensure durability and ease of application. Stencil Materials: Choose sturdy, reusable stencils capable of handling large-scale bridge applications without tearing. Bridges are exposed to harsh environmental conditions, including wind, rain, and temperature fluctuations, which can stress the stencil material. Opt for materials like polycarbonate, Mylar, or heavy-duty plastic, which are known for their resilience and ability to withstand repeated use. These materials are less likely to tear or warp, ensuring clean and consistent results even on rough bridge surfaces.
The thickness of the stencil material is another critical factor. For bridge stenciling, select stencils with a thickness of at least 10 mils to provide the necessary strength and flexibility. Thicker materials are better equipped to handle the pressure of paint application tools, such as rollers or sprayers, without bending or breaking. Additionally, thicker stencils are easier to clean and reuse, making them a cost-effective choice for large-scale projects like bridge painting.
Reusability is a key consideration, especially for extensive bridge stenciling projects. Invest in stencils designed for multiple uses, as this reduces waste and long-term costs. Materials like Mylar or polycarbonate are ideal because they can be cleaned with solvents and reused dozens of times without losing their shape or detail. Ensure the stencils have smooth edges and secure adhesive backing (if applicable) to prevent paint bleed and maintain sharp lines, which is essential for professional-looking results on bridges.
For large-scale bridge applications, the size and design of the stencil also matter. Choose stencils that are appropriately sized for the bridge surface to minimize seams and ensure even coverage. Custom-cut stencils may be necessary for intricate designs or specific bridge dimensions. Additionally, consider stencils with reinforced edges or built-in handles for easier positioning and stability during application, as these features enhance durability and usability on such a demanding surface.
Lastly, the environmental impact of the stencil material should not be overlooked. Opt for eco-friendly, non-toxic materials that are safe for both the applicator and the surrounding environment. Bridges are often located in public areas or near water bodies, so using materials that do not leach harmful chemicals is essential. By prioritizing durability, reusability, and sustainability, you can ensure that your stencils perform effectively while minimizing their ecological footprint.

Application Techniques: Apply paint evenly, avoiding drips or smudges for professional and lasting bridge designs
When stenciling bridges, achieving a professional and lasting design hinges on precise paint application. The key is to apply paint evenly, ensuring a smooth and consistent finish while avoiding drips or smudges that can detract from the overall appearance. Start by selecting the appropriate paint and tools for the surface material of the bridge, whether it’s metal, wood, or concrete. Using high-quality stencil brushes or spray paint specifically designed for outdoor use will significantly improve the outcome. Prepare the surface by cleaning it thoroughly and ensuring it is dry and free of debris to allow the paint to adhere properly.
To apply paint evenly, use a light-handed technique, especially when working with brushes. Dip only the tips of the bristles into the paint and tap off any excess on a palette or paper towel to prevent overloading. For spray paint, hold the can 6–8 inches away from the surface and apply in smooth, even strokes, overlapping each pass slightly to avoid streaks. Work in sections, following the stencil’s design carefully, and allow each layer to dry before adding additional coats or details. This layered approach ensures depth and durability without causing the paint to pool or drip.
Avoiding drips and smudges requires patience and attention to detail. When using brushes, apply paint in a stippling or dabbing motion rather than brushing back and forth, which can dislodge the stencil or cause smearing. If using spray paint, maintain a consistent distance and speed to prevent oversaturation. In humid or cold conditions, adjust your technique by applying thinner coats and allowing more drying time between layers. Always secure the stencil firmly in place with tape or adhesive spray to prevent shifting during application, which can lead to smudges.
For intricate bridge designs, consider using multiple stencils or masking techniques to isolate specific areas. This allows you to focus on one section at a time, reducing the risk of accidental smudges or drips in adjacent areas. If mistakes occur, address them immediately by gently lifting the stencil and using a small brush or cotton swab to correct the error before the paint dries. For larger drips, wait until the paint is completely dry and carefully sand or scrape the area before retouching.
Finally, sealing the finished design is crucial for longevity, especially on outdoor bridges exposed to weather and wear. Apply a clear, outdoor-rated sealant using even strokes, ensuring full coverage without pooling. This protective layer not only enhances the vibrancy of the paint but also guards against chipping, fading, and moisture damage. By mastering these application techniques and taking the time to apply paint evenly while avoiding drips or smudges, you can create professional and lasting bridge designs that stand the test of time.

Maintenance Tips: Regularly inspect and touch up stenciled areas to maintain bridge aesthetics and durability
Regularly inspecting and touching up stenciled areas on bridges is crucial for preserving both their aesthetic appeal and structural integrity. Stenciled designs, whether decorative or functional, are exposed to harsh environmental conditions such as UV radiation, rain, snow, and temperature fluctuations, which can cause paint to fade, crack, or peel over time. Establishing a routine inspection schedule, ideally every six months or after severe weather events, allows maintenance teams to identify early signs of wear and address them before they worsen. Inspections should focus on areas prone to damage, such as surfaces exposed to direct sunlight, areas with high moisture retention, and sections subjected to frequent physical contact or abrasion.
When conducting inspections, it’s essential to document the condition of the stenciled areas with notes and photographs. This documentation helps track deterioration patterns and ensures that touch-ups are consistent with the original design. Look for signs of paint chipping, discoloration, or underlying corrosion, as these issues can compromise both the appearance and protective qualities of the paint. If the stencil design includes multiple layers or colors, inspect each layer individually to ensure all components remain intact and visually cohesive. Early detection of problems not only maintains the bridge’s aesthetic appeal but also prevents more extensive and costly repairs in the future.
Touching up stenciled areas requires careful preparation to ensure the new paint adheres properly and blends seamlessly with the existing design. Begin by cleaning the surface thoroughly to remove dirt, grime, and loose paint particles. Use a mild detergent and water, followed by a rinse and complete drying before proceeding. If the original stencil is still intact, carefully realign the stencil to match the existing design. For faded or partially damaged areas, lightly sand the surface to create a smooth base for the new paint, taking care not to damage the underlying material.
Selecting the right paint and materials is critical for successful touch-ups. Use the same type and color of paint originally applied to ensure consistency. If the original paint details are unavailable, consult the manufacturer or a professional to match the color and finish as closely as possible. Apply the paint in thin, even coats, allowing each layer to dry completely before adding the next. For larger or more complex stenciled designs, consider involving a professional painter or artist to maintain precision and quality. Proper application techniques not only restore the appearance but also enhance the paint’s durability against environmental stressors.
In addition to regular inspections and touch-ups, implementing preventive measures can extend the lifespan of stenciled areas on bridges. Applying a protective clear coat over the paint can provide an additional barrier against UV rays, moisture, and abrasion. Ensure proper drainage around the bridge to minimize water accumulation, which can accelerate paint deterioration. For high-traffic areas or surfaces prone to vandalism, consider using anti-graffiti coatings or more durable paint formulations. By combining routine maintenance with proactive measures, bridge managers can preserve the beauty and functionality of stenciled designs for years to come.
